Skip to content

Instantly share code, notes, and snippets.

View raul-arabaolaza's full-sized avatar

Raúl Arabaolaza Barquin raul-arabaolaza

View GitHub Profile
public class UTrackerConfFile {
private Create create;
private Close close;
private Label label;
public Create getCreate() {
@raul-arabaolaza
raul-arabaolaza / Dispatcher.java
Created January 2, 2023 10:06
Generated Dispatcher
@Singleton
public class GitHubEventDispatcherImpl {
@Inject
protected Event eventEmitter;
@Inject
protected GitHubService gitHubService;
public GitHubEventDispatcherImpl() {
}
@raul-arabaolaza
raul-arabaolaza / Multiplexer.java
Created January 2, 2023 09:57
Generated Multiplexer
@Multiplexer
@Singleton
public class UTracker_Multiplexer extends UTracker {
@Inject
protected ErrorHandler errorHandler;
public UTracker_Multiplexer() {
}
public void onClose_c3c08617767ea721ba21db82feaf848c10a4421a(@ObservesAsync @Closed MultiplexedEvent var1, RequestScopeCachingGitHubConfigFileProvider var2) {
@raul-arabaolaza
raul-arabaolaza / generate.sh
Last active March 19, 2020 02:04
Systemd init script for cloudbees products installed via rpm on centos and RHEL 7
#/bin/bash
JENKINS_WAR="/usr/lib/@@ARTIFACTNAME@@/@@ARTIFACTNAME@@.war"
test -r "$JENKINS_WAR" || { echo "$JENKINS_WAR not installed";
if [ "$1" = "stop" ]; then exit 0;
else exit 5; fi; }
# Check for existence of needed config file and read it
JENKINS_CONFIG=/etc/sysconfig/@@ARTIFACTNAME@@
test -e "$JENKINS_CONFIG" || { echo "$JENKINS_CONFIG not existing";
if [ "$1" = "stop" ]; then exit 0;
<dependency>
<groupId>org.jenkins-ci.plugins.workflow</groupId>
<artifactId>workflow-aggregator</artifactId>
<version>1.15</version>
</dependency>
<dependency>
<groupId>org.jenkins-ci.plugins</groupId>
<artifactId>github-api</artifactId>
<version>1.90</version>
</dependency>

Keybase proof

I hereby claim:

  • I am raul-arabaolaza on github.
  • I am rarabaolaza (https://keybase.io/rarabaolaza) on keybase.
  • I have a public key whose fingerprint is 2FE9 A01A 2B1E 2B34 D5AF 8F3B 5378 1163 6702 96DA

To claim this, I am signing this object: